HAIR CARE ROUTINE STEPS FOR HEALTHY HAIR
Every basic haircare routine contains some important steps: cleansing, conditioning, moisturising, detangling, styling and treatment. The frequency of these steps will depend on your hair type, lifestyle and preferences. Let’s cover the basics:
Step 1
Oil massage
How to oil your hair
Massaging the oil into the scalp increases blood circulation, which may improve
hair growth. Applying oil to the scalp may also prevent dandruffTrusted Source.
Follow these steps to give hair oiling a try:
Apply oil on your scalp and massage with fingertips using a circular motion.
Apply the oil left on your palms to your hair.
Cover with a towel or shower cap and leave on overnight.
The next day, shampoo hair while dry. Rinse thoroughly.
Condition as normal. You can also use coconut oil as a conditioner.
Benefits of oiling hair
Oils play an important role in protecting hair from regular wear and tear. Oiling hair regularly reduces hygral fatigueTrusted Source, or the swelling and drying of hair. Oils protect the follicle from surfactants by filling the gap between cuticle cells
step 2
Cleansing
How do I deep clean my scalp?
Are you guilty of rubbing some shampoo, followed by conditioner, on to your hair, rinsing it off, and away you go? This routine’s great for giving your hair a general clean, but it won’t give it a deep-down clean. Plus, your scalp often gets overlooked in the process too. There are a fair few ways to clean your scalp.
1.Massage your scalp
Rather than just plop your products on, really massage them (gently) into your scalp. This can help to improve blood flow, aid the natural process of hair growth and improve the overall condition of your hair.
2. Comb your scalp
Grab a brush and gently comb your scalp gently. In doing so, you’ll help remove the build-up of excess skin and dislodge any debris or dandruff.
3. Use an oil treatment
Massage it onto your scalp, leave it on for the required time, and then wash off to reveal a clean scalp and hair. (Note – steer clear of oil treatments if your hair is blonde and oily, as hair oils are more prone to building up).
Step 3
Condition
How to Use Conditioner After Shampoo
After shampooing and rinsing hair squeeze the appropriate amount of conditioner into the palm of your hand
Apply to the lengths and ends of your hair working into the most damaged areas first
Rinse out the conditioner.
Step 4
Repair with a hair mask
A hair mask, also known as a deep conditioning treatment, is a type of hair conditioner to hydrate and improve overall hair health. Hair masks contain natural oils, natural butters, and plant extracts to boost the hair's moisture and add nutrients to the hair follicles. A hair mask can help repair damage from heat styling, the local environment, and color treatment. Applying hair masks as part of your hair care routine can also improve your scalp health and strengthen your hair.
hair mask safe for hair?
Those with very dry and damaged hair could benefit from using a hydrating hair mask two or three times a week, while those with greasy hair may want to stick to the recommended once a week. If you've got very straight hair, then you should also avoid using a hair mask more than twice a week
Step 5
Treat with head serum
Serum for hair is a thick solution enriched with active ingredients. It helps control frizzy hair, improves growth, and forms a coating over the hair to protect them from environmental stressors. Its regular use can prevent seasonal dryness and a lack of nourishment
Is it good to apply hair serum daily?
Treat your hair with a serum every time you wash your tresses, so, if you wash your hair every day, apply your serum daily. It helps protect your hair from environmental aggressors and provides moisture. Since your hair is brittle and dry after washing, it is recommended to use serum on wash day
